Superdrug has seen a rise in hairlice products (Image: Getty) Headlice is probably something we had while we were at school but now Superdrug has warned parents after a recent surge in infestations. The retailer reported a staggering 121 percent increase in sales for their head lice treatment spray. As the warmer weather approaches it can be a trigger for head lice.
